The North East chapter of the All Progressives Congress (APC) today officially endorsed the Tinubu/Kashim ticket for the 2027 presidential election.

The unanimous decision was reached during the North East All Progressives Congress Consultative Meeting held in Gombe, the Gombe State capital, drawing thousands of party members and top officials from across the zone.

Governors Babagana Zulum of Borno, Mai-Mala Buni of Yobe, and Inuwa Yahaya of Gombe were prominent among the attendees, signaling a strong regional consensus behind the current leadership.

Other significant figures present included the National Chairman of APC, Dr. Abdullahi Umar Ganduje, and Deputy National Chairman, Dr. Ali Bukar Dalori.

According to Dauda Illiya, Governor Zulum's spokesperson, the forum lauded President Bola Tinubu and Vice President Kashim Shettima, asserting that their “Renewed Hope Agenda” has significantly transformed Nigeria in their short term of leadership.

They collectively urged all Nigerians to rally behind the ticket, emphasizing its promise of unity, progress, and hope for the nation.

In his address, Borno State Governor, Professor Babagana Zulum, highlighted the achievements of the Tinubu/Shettima-led government over the past two years.

He specifically cited notable progress in critical sectors such as health, education, youth and women empowerment, revenue generation, and a general improvement in the lives of citizens.

The endorsement signifies a strong show of support from a key geopolitical zone for the current administration, setting the stage for the upcoming 2027 presidential election.
